## Deploying the Gatewick Proctor Queue

Deploys are pretty painless: push to main, wait for the pipeline, then watch the queue drain dashboard for five minutes. If candidates pile up mid-exam, roll back first and ask questions later — the queue replays safely. Everything the workers care about lives in one config block, shown here for reference.

settings of bafof-yagef:
JOROX_PIN=8740
JOROX_TENANT=pelox
JOROX_METRICS_HOST=metrics.jorox.qorvelworks.internal
JOROX_SEAL=seal_c78f63c1
JOROX_STANDBY_TEAM=norax

Quarterly Planning Note — Second-Source Supplier Search

Sales leads: Brennick Components remains our sole supplier for the Varro actuator line. Risk is unacceptable. We are qualifying two alternates this quarter — Ostlund Precision and Caveridge Manufacturing. Trial orders ship in week six. Do not commit delivery dates on Varro products beyond ninety days until qualification completes. Pricing impact expected to be minor. The confidential note on business plans appears below.

management briefing: Project Ulavan slips by two quarters because of the staffing delay.

Welcome to Brindlewood House! If the fire alarm goes off (we drill every quarter, usually Tuesdays), head straight out to the gravel courtyard by the old cedar tree. Don't stop to grab your laptop. Roll call happens at the muster point, where a warden from the Tamsin Vale team ticks you off the list. To make that quick, they'll scan your pass, so keep it on you. Here's the code you'll need for re-entry afterwards.

badge for fafop-fajof: bdg-Z-47